It was announced today that Royal Caribbean will be retiring two more ships from their fleet. These two ships are the Empress of the Seas and the Majesty of the Seas.
The release of these two ships is to keep and increase the fleet with ships that are more energy efficient and eco-friendly.
Clients currently booked to sail on any of these two ships will have their reservations transferred to another ship. Communications will soon be released as to what options that are available to these guests.
